Understanding Digital Demonstration Platforms in the Public Sector

Digital demonstration platforms are immersive environments that simulate real-world conditions for testing new technology, processes, or policies before wide-scale deployment. They serve as critical intermediaries—bridging conceptual ideas to practical, scalable solutions—mitigating the costly risks of live implementation.

Such platforms typically incorporate features like vir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), data analytics, and interactive dashboards. They facilitate iterative development cycles, allowing policymakers and technologists to experiment with different scenarios and gather valuable feedback.

Case Studies: Transforming Governance Through Digital Prototypes

Leading examples illustrate how demonstration platforms are enabling governments to innovate confidently:

  • Urban Mobility: Cities are deploying virtual models of transportation networks to optimise flow and reduce emissions, using platforms similar to Blue Wizzard’s capabilities to simulate user behaviour and infrastructure constraints.
  • Healthcare Planning: Simulated environments facilitate policy testing for pandemic response, resource allocation, and patient flow management, providing data-driven insights without risking real-world consequences.
  • Public Engagement: Virtual town halls and interactive dashboards foster citizen participation, ensuring policies are more inclusive and reflective of community needs.

These examples exemplify the transformative impact of digital demonstration environments, which promote evidence-based policy making and bolster public trust.
